City Council Decision

City Council on October 2, 3 and 4, 2017, adopted the following:  

 

1.  City Council approve the 2018 meeting schedule dates in Attachment 1 to the report (June 15, 2017) from the City Clerk and that the published schedule serve as notice for these meetings.

 

2.  City Council request the City Clerk to distribute the approved schedule to the City's agencies and special purpose bodies with a request that they:

 

a. avoid scheduling meetings, whenever possible, that conflict with the approved schedule; and

 

b. avoid scheduling public meetings, forums, public consultations and large scale meetings on days of cultural or religious significance as noted in the approved schedule.

3 - Motion to Amend Item moved by Councillor Giorgio Mammoliti (Out of Order)

That City Council meetings be scheduled for 2 days only and that City Council be cut in half.

Ruling by Speaker Frances Nunziata
Speaker Nunziata ruled motion 3 by Councillor Mammoliti out of order as the number of Members of Council is not before City Council.
